This video tutorial covers the preterite tense in Spanish, focusing on both regular and irregular verbs. It begins with a review of regular verb endings for AR, ER, and IR verbs, and highlights the unique spelling changes in the 'yo' form for certain verbs. The tutorial then introduces four new irregular verbs: tener, estar, poder, and hacer, explaining their conjugation in the preterite tense. Key techniques for conjugating these verbs are discussed, including the removal of accent marks and the use of specific verb endings. The video concludes with practice exercises and preparation tips for an upcoming quiz.
